01 -
Fill a large pot with 2-3 inches of water and add the broccoli florets with 1 teaspoon of salt. Cover and bring to a simmer, then reduce heat to low and steam for 6 minutes until the broccoli is tender-crisp. Drain in a colander and rinse with cold water to stop the cooking process - this keeps it bright green and perfectly tender.
02 -
In a small bowl, whisk together the soy sauce, water, sesame oil, honey, rice vinegar, grated ginger, minced garlic, cornstarch, and sesame seeds until smooth. This sauce is going to be absolutely delicious - the perfect balance of sweet, savory, and nutty!
03 -
Place the chicken pieces in a large plastic bag. In a small bowl, whisk together the cornstarch, flour, salt, and pepper. Add this mixture to the bag with the chicken, seal it up, and shake until every piece is evenly coated. This light coating will give you the perfect golden crust.
04 -
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Once the oil is shimmering, add the chicken pieces in a single layer - don't overcrowd! Let them cook undisturbed for 2-3 minutes until golden, then flip and cook until all sides are golden brown and the chicken is cooked through with no pink in the center.
05 -
Reduce heat to medium-low and pour the prepared sauce over the golden chicken. Toss to coat and let the sauce simmer until it thickens beautifully - this should take just a minute or two. The aroma will be incredible!
06 -
If your skillet is large enough, gently fold the steamed broccoli into the saucy chicken. If not, transfer everything to a large serving bowl and toss together. Sprinkle with diced green onions and serve immediately while hot. Every bite is pure comfort food perfection!
